What Makes Telford Challenging

Key Challenges

  • Adjusting to varying speed limits through extended built-up areas
  • Crossing narrow canal bridges where only one vehicle can pass at a time
  • Navigating suburban estates with speed bumps, mini-roundabouts, and parked cars
  • Responding to complex road layouts in older market town centres

Difficulty Analysis

At 43.9%, Telford falls slightly below the national average of 51.8%, ranking 49 out of 322 centres for difficulty. Pass rates have improved modestly over recent years, moving from 40.8% to 43.9%, a gradual gain of 3.1 percentage points. Younger candidates at 17 perform notably well here with a 53.9% pass rate, compared to an average of 43.0% for those aged 22-25.

How to Pass Your Driving Test at Telford

Expert Tips

  1. 1

    Master multi-lane roundabout technique, as roundabouts are the defining junction type of West Midlands test routes.

  2. 2

    Practise dual carriageway driving with frequent exit/entry slip roads.

  3. 3

    Work on speed limit awareness through extended built-up areas where limits change frequently.

  4. 4

    Get comfortable with mini-roundabouts, common in suburban areas and testing your observation and timing.

  5. 5

    Work on smooth transitions between 20, 30, and 40 mph zones, as speed changes are frequent in suburban areas.

Best Time to Test

Midweek tests at Telford tend to have calmer traffic conditions than Monday or Friday slots, giving candidates a less pressured environment.

Frequently Asked Questions About Telford

What is the pass rate at Telford?+

The current pass rate at Telford is 43.9%. The national average is 51.8%. These figures are based on 5,663 tests conducted during April 2024 - March 2025. The male pass rate is 44.2% and the female pass rate is 43.7%.

Is Telford a hard driving test centre?+

Telford is ranked 49 out of 322 UK test centres for difficulty and is classified as "Below Average". The pass rate is below the national average, which may indicate a more challenging test experience.
